diff options
author | Henrik Brix Andersen <brix@gentoo.org> | 2006-06-25 00:29:26 +0000 |
---|---|---|
committer | Henrik Brix Andersen <brix@gentoo.org> | 2006-06-25 00:29:26 +0000 |
commit | 7c999e93e0961a27f599e97e2fcf82ea09bd239a (patch) | |
tree | c340401e6d1853a6317271273039b01442695750 | |
parent | merged into sys-apps/setarch (diff) | |
download | historical-7c999e93e0961a27f599e97e2fcf82ea09bd239a.tar.gz historical-7c999e93e0961a27f599e97e2fcf82ea09bd239a.tar.bz2 historical-7c999e93e0961a27f599e97e2fcf82ea09bd239a.zip |
The gimp-print and gnome-print plug-ins were removed upstream, new GTK+ print plug-in awaits addition of gtk+-2.9.3. Cleaned up a bit.
Package-Manager: portage-2.1
-rw-r--r-- | media-gfx/gimp/ChangeLog | 6 | ||||
-rw-r--r-- | media-gfx/gimp/Manifest | 16 | ||||
-rw-r--r-- | media-gfx/gimp/gimp-9999.ebuild | 34 |
3 files changed, 31 insertions, 25 deletions
diff --git a/media-gfx/gimp/ChangeLog b/media-gfx/gimp/ChangeLog index 33e684ad3c76..01b6db9b0fc0 100644 --- a/media-gfx/gimp/ChangeLog +++ b/media-gfx/gimp/ChangeLog @@ -1,6 +1,10 @@ # ChangeLog for media-gfx/gimp # Copyright 2002-2006 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/media-gfx/gimp/ChangeLog,v 1.151 2006/06/18 20:03:59 brix Exp $ +# $Header: /var/cvsroot/gentoo-x86/media-gfx/gimp/ChangeLog,v 1.152 2006/06/25 00:29:26 brix Exp $ + + 25 Jun 2006; Henrik Brix Andersen <brix@gentoo.org> gimp-9999.ebuild: + The gimp-print and gnome-print plug-ins were removed upstream, new GTK+ + print plug-in awaits addition of gtk+-2.9.3. Cleaned up a bit. 18 Jun 2006; Henrik Brix Andersen <brix@gentoo.org> gimp-9999.ebuild: Work around AA variable (strictly only needed for non-CVS ebuilds), do not diff --git a/media-gfx/gimp/Manifest b/media-gfx/gimp/Manifest index 033ea80a55e5..223ef9719ed5 100644 --- a/media-gfx/gimp/Manifest +++ b/media-gfx/gimp/Manifest @@ -60,14 +60,14 @@ EBUILD gimp-2.2.9.ebuild 4402 RMD160 314d4f318845bfb602cf648b857170fa247a62c9 SH MD5 48eb45febb4d78146c4b9f48b6b511a7 gimp-2.2.9.ebuild 4402 RMD160 314d4f318845bfb602cf648b857170fa247a62c9 gimp-2.2.9.ebuild 4402 SHA256 79dc33dbd739ffc2e96e1baa670c23b929ce0d0f4e79f3536ec893998a9cc4bb gimp-2.2.9.ebuild 4402 -EBUILD gimp-9999.ebuild 3674 RMD160 89a36c832653e369ca3f9d10a1a7287bbfb6e773 SHA1 5ea40291d3dc1688afac732ec480b1325bd0163a SHA256 54c3a47a52f773bce2e44a921309c05a049a11571073b84a7f58d973c266a54c -MD5 b48b186f357b13644a60abf3ecbb369d gimp-9999.ebuild 3674 -RMD160 89a36c832653e369ca3f9d10a1a7287bbfb6e773 gimp-9999.ebuild 3674 -SHA256 54c3a47a52f773bce2e44a921309c05a049a11571073b84a7f58d973c266a54c gimp-9999.ebuild 3674 -MISC ChangeLog 22232 RMD160 d44066f51e203c847fddfb8b6a5cf56bf9cff5a5 SHA1 347be962607a5d12afec5e909c031066bed5b481 SHA256 214d92f533b9875ddc0730d5efa7da88b8f5ba804c471de0adc85d45c0bc4800 -MD5 d2c87fbf124594945bb2be2e3814406b ChangeLog 22232 -RMD160 d44066f51e203c847fddfb8b6a5cf56bf9cff5a5 ChangeLog 22232 -SHA256 214d92f533b9875ddc0730d5efa7da88b8f5ba804c471de0adc85d45c0bc4800 ChangeLog 22232 +EBUILD gimp-9999.ebuild 3747 RMD160 966a6cddc7b66ef865e4e4bfe300e4cfc9f28530 SHA1 695bc45ef36450fd8dd6feee7fa9ad315ae404f2 SHA256 c89fc4b85a5f70b43a28d352edaffcc2ef2e52fd0a48817d9d5687213e8cf51b +MD5 cb28e0f4fd31a202c20e3fa91b8b79b8 gimp-9999.ebuild 3747 +RMD160 966a6cddc7b66ef865e4e4bfe300e4cfc9f28530 gimp-9999.ebuild 3747 +SHA256 c89fc4b85a5f70b43a28d352edaffcc2ef2e52fd0a48817d9d5687213e8cf51b gimp-9999.ebuild 3747 +MISC ChangeLog 22444 RMD160 4b71ea6aca13ec914b95ad9ba7de6bd50f959ecb SHA1 98593f78cb01cefc2d10252c7fcab1a655542763 SHA256 9c9ff16521540107818bd0337e5e1b9e38fda643d621a3459b81d41b34819302 +MD5 bfdf8ab35daa6b30ba5ebc0368b75f8c ChangeLog 22444 +RMD160 4b71ea6aca13ec914b95ad9ba7de6bd50f959ecb ChangeLog 22444 +SHA256 9c9ff16521540107818bd0337e5e1b9e38fda643d621a3459b81d41b34819302 ChangeLog 22444 MISC metadata.xml 369 RMD160 b71b3f982cd3a530df18bb05a2a32430e0c1daea SHA1 1c448e18bc74a560156318c4d9186b4e31ccba0c SHA256 4fbdad87f03de0aa7de4d07707a4d870d2c0cba55fc3cd563dae0945620d763d MD5 cda75d04f4767d3920ffc234e66d95c7 metadata.xml 369 RMD160 b71b3f982cd3a530df18bb05a2a32430e0c1daea metadata.xml 369 diff --git a/media-gfx/gimp/gimp-9999.ebuild b/media-gfx/gimp/gimp-9999.ebuild index a86dd75dd9c3..d98f3ea91991 100644 --- a/media-gfx/gimp/gimp-9999.ebuild +++ b/media-gfx/gimp/gimp-9999.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/media-gfx/gimp/gimp-9999.ebuild,v 1.4 2006/06/18 20:03:59 brix Exp $ +# $Header: /var/cvsroot/gentoo-x86/media-gfx/gimp/gimp-9999.ebuild,v 1.5 2006/06/25 00:29:26 brix Exp $ inherit alternatives cvs eutils fdo-mime flag-o-matic @@ -19,8 +19,11 @@ LICENSE="GPL-2" SLOT="2" KEYWORDS="-*" -IUSE="alsa aalib altivec debug doc gtkhtml gimpprint gnome jpeg lcms mmx mng pdf png python smp sse svg tiff wmf" +# add 'print' when >=x11-libs/gtk+-2.9.3 hits portage +IUSE="alsa aalib altivec debug doc gtkhtml gnome jpeg lcms mmx mng pdf png python smp sse svg tiff wmf" +# not yet in portage: +# print? ( >=x11-libs/gtk+-2.9.3 ) RDEPEND=">=dev-libs/glib-2.8.2 >=x11-libs/gtk+-2.8.8 >=x11-libs/pango-1.4 @@ -34,14 +37,12 @@ RDEPEND=">=dev-libs/glib-2.8.2 aalib? ( media-libs/aalib ) alsa? ( >=media-libs/alsa-lib-1.0.0 ) doc? ( app-doc/gimp-help ) - gimpprint? ( =media-gfx/gimp-print-4.2* ) gnome? ( >=gnome-base/gnome-vfs-2.10.0 >=gnome-base/libgnomeui-2.10.0 - >=gnome-base/gnome-keyring-0.4.5 - >=gnome-base/libgnomeprint-2.10.0 ) + >=gnome-base/gnome-keyring-0.4.5 ) gtkhtml? ( =gnome-extra/gtkhtml-2* ) jpeg? ( >=media-libs/jpeg-6b-r2 - media-libs/libexif ) + >=media-libs/libexif-0.6.0 ) lcms? ( media-libs/lcms ) mng? ( media-libs/libmng ) pdf? ( >=app-text/poppler-bindings-0.3.1 ) @@ -50,7 +51,7 @@ RDEPEND=">=dev-libs/glib-2.8.2 >=dev-python/pygtk-2 ) tiff? ( >=media-libs/tiff-3.5.7 ) svg? ( >=gnome-base/librsvg-2.2 ) - wmf? ( >=media-libs/libwmf-0.2.8.2 )" + wmf? ( >=media-libs/libwmf-0.2.8 )" DEPEND="${RDEPEND} >=dev-util/pkgconfig-0.12.0 >=dev-util/intltool-0.31 @@ -59,10 +60,10 @@ DEPEND="${RDEPEND} pkg_setup() { if use pdf && ! built_with_use app-text/poppler-bindings gtk; then eerror - eerror "This package requires app-text/poppler compiled with GTK+ support." - eerror "Please reemerge app-text/poppler with USE=\"gtk\"." + eerror "This package requires app-text/poppler-bindings compiled with GTK+ support." + eerror "Please reemerge app-text/poppler-bindings with USE=\"gtk\"." eerror - die "Please reemerge app-text/poppler with USE=\"gtk\"." + die "Please reemerge app-text/poppler-bindings with USE=\"gtk\"." fi } @@ -74,14 +75,17 @@ src_unpack() { } src_compile() { - # gimp uses inline functions (plug-ins/common/grid.c) (#23078) + # workaround portage variable leakage + local AA= + + # gimp uses inline functions (e.g. plug-ins/common/grid.c) (#23078) # gimp uses floating point math, needs accuracy (#98685) filter-flags "-fno-inline" "-ffast-math" "${S}"/autogen.sh $(use_enable doc gtk-doc) || die "autogen.sh failed" - # Workaround portage variable leakage - local AA= + # requires >=x11-libs/gtk+-2.9.3, which is not yet in portaqe + # $(use_with print) \ econf \ --disable-default-binary \ @@ -91,8 +95,6 @@ src_compile() { $(use_enable altivec) \ $(use_enable debug) \ $(use_enable doc gtk-doc) \ - $(use_enable gimpprint print) \ - $(use_with gnome gnome-print) \ $(use_with gtkhtml gtkhtml2) \ $(use_with jpeg libjpeg) \ $(use_with jpeg libexif) \ @@ -120,7 +122,7 @@ src_install() { pkg_postinst() { local binary - # install symlinks for everything but gimptool (bug #136012) + # install symlinks for everything but gimptool (#136012) for binary in gimp gimp-console gimp-remote; do alternatives_auto_makesym "/usr/bin/${binary}" "/usr/bin/${binary}-[0-9].[0-9]" done |